Navigating the Buying Process: Legalities and Procedures
Navigating the buying process for Pima Arizona Homes For Sale involves understanding both the legalities and procedures inherent to the transaction. In this competitive market, buyers must be well-informed about their rights and obligations. One of the first steps is to secure pre-approval for a mortgage from a lender. This not only gives you a clear budget but also makes your offer more compelling when competing with other buyers. For instance, in 2022, the average home price in Pima Arizona ranged between $350,000 and $450,000, according to local real estate trends. Pre-approval demonstrates to sellers that you are a serious and qualified buyer.
Once pre-approved, it’s crucial to work with an experienced real estate agent like West USA Realty who understands the Pima Arizona market and can guide you through the entire process. They’ll help identify suitable properties, negotiate offers, and ensure all legal documentation is in order. A common misconception is that buying a home is merely a financial transaction; however, it’s also a legal one. Contracts, disclosures, and inspections are critical components that must be handled correctly to avoid future issues. For example, a home inspection in Pima Arizona typically covers structural integrity, electrical systems, plumbing, and heating/cooling units.
During the due diligence period after making an offer, careful review of all documents is essential. This includes the title search, which verifies ownership history and ensures no liens or encumbrances exist on the property. Once your offer is accepted, you’ll need to work with a lawyer or closing agent to finalize the sale. They’ll prepare the settlement statement, handle the funds transfer, and ensure all legal formalities are completed.
